@norahkathleen why 64oz? Individual hydration needs vary from person to person and even day-to-day within the same person, and it is actually possible to over-hydrate and create more problems. So if you have trouble drinking that much, don't force it. If your pee is light yellow, like the color of straw or champagne, you're good. If it's lighter than that, you're drinking too much water. If it's darker than that, you're not drinking enough water.7 -
